Peter Singer's big idea tries to recast philanthropy
Peter Singer is a philosopher and professor of bioethics at Princeton University who has gained recognition for his work on effective altruism. Effective altruism is a philosophy and social movement that seeks to improve the world through rational decision-making and evidence-based approaches to charitable giving and advocacy. Singer is considered one of the key figures in the effective altruism movement, and his work has been influential in shaping the movement's values and goals.
